Playoff Implications as Colts Face Texans

As the NFL season reaches its climax, the Indianapolis Colts are set to host the Houston Texans at Lucas Oil Stadium on Saturday, January 6. Fans can catch the action live on ESPN/ABC, witnessing what promises to be a pivotal game with significant playoff implications.

The Colts have had a rollercoaster season but find themselves in contention for postseason play, currently holding the seventh seed in the AFC playoffs. Their path to this point was secured following a critical victory over the Las Vegas Raiders in Week 17, a win that not only kept their playoff hopes alive but also highlighted their resilience.

Interestingly, the Colts share an identical record with their upcoming opponents, the Texans, as well as with the Pittsburgh Steelers and Jacksonville Jaguars. This parity sets the stage for a dramatic finish to the regular season, where every game has the potential to shuffle the playoff landscape.

Scenarios for Colts' Playoff Hopes

For the Colts, the equation is simple yet daunting: a win against the Texans would guarantee them an AFC wild-card berth. However, there's more at stake than just securing a playoff spot. If the Colts emerge victorious and the Jaguars fall to the Titans, the Colts would ascend to become the AFC South champions, a remarkable turnaround given their challenges throughout the season.

Rookie Leadership for the Texans

The Texans, led by rookie head coach DeMeco Ryans and quarterback C.J. Stroud, are looking to upset the Colts' playoff aspirations. Despite losing to the Colts 31-20 in Week 2, the Texans have shown growth and development under their new leadership. Stroud, in particular, has displayed poise beyond his years, emphasizing the importance of confidence and relentless effort in his approach to the game.

"We’re really just going to go out there with confidence. That was the main thing we talked about today, being relentless in every single thing that we do," Stroud remarked, highlighting the team's mindset heading into the weekend.

Stroud also touched on the mental aspect of the game, acknowledging the natural nerves that come with competition while underscoring the importance of preparation, "Of course, there are going to be nerves. I’m naturally nervous every game, but I just think those are probably the reason why I just lock in to my preparation and things like that."

Colts' Resilient Season

The Colts' journey to this point has been nothing short of tumultuous. After enduring the NFL's worst point margin in the 2022 season, the organization made the difficult decision to part ways with coach Frank Reich midseason. Yet, despite these challenges and a three-game losing streak, including a defeat in Atlanta in Week 16, the Colts have fought their way back into playoff contention.

Alec Pierce, reflecting on the transformation from last season, noted the shift in atmosphere, "It's truly night and day. It's been great this year to be playing for something meaningful. Last year was definitely different." The sentiment echoes throughout the locker room, where the focus is on seizing the opportunity at hand.

Grover Stewart, known for his clutch performances, expressed his readiness to rise to the occasion, "I like to be put under pressure. Time for big-time players to step up and make big plays." His words encapsulate the Colts' mentality as they prepare for a game that could define their season.
